Understanding the Shift Toward Digital Innovation in Drone Sports
The rise of competitive drone racing, known as FPV (First Person View) racing, has prompted manufacturers and developers to innovate beyond traditional physical tracks. These innovations are not merely about refining hardware but also involve creating compelling digital platforms that serve as both training tools and entertainment mediums. Industry data indicates that virtual simulation platforms have grown by approximately 30% annually over the past three years, highlighting an increasing appetite for realistic and accessible drone racing experiences.
Key to this digital shift is the ability for enthusiasts and professionals to replicate real-world racing dynamics in virtual environments, enabling skill development, event organization, and community engagement without logistical barriers like weather, location, or equipment costs.
